Caterina Valente & Edmundo Ros

This collaboration between Caterina Valente and Edmundo Ros is certainly one of her greatest albums, rhythmic and romantic by turns. It was first issued on LP in 1960 in Germany (as LATEIN AMERIKANISCHE RHYTHMEN) and the USA (as FIRE & FRENZY), both of which were available in mono and stereo. Ironically, this British-made recording wasn’t released in the UK itself until 1964 (as LATINO), and then in mono only!

The current coupling is SOUTH OF THE BORDER, a 1962 album of Mexican songs performed by Caterina and arranged and conducted by Werner Mueller. This in turn could otherwise have been teamed with CATERINA VALENTE’S GREATEST HITS (1966), with which it has a number of links: same conductor, similar Latin-American repertoire, and one track (LA GOLONDRINA) which was originally intended for the former album but ultimately incorporated into the latter. Be that as it may, the existing FIRE & FRENZY/SOUTH OF THE BORDER combination is a perfectly enjoyable disc for aficionados of Caterina’s way with Latin-American material.
